Why Lithium Batteries Are the Future of Power Storage in Pakistan
Lithium batteries are now widely adopted across the renewable energy and backup power sectors because they offer:
• Longer Lifespan: A typical lithium battery can deliver thousands of charge and discharge cycles often significantly more than lead‑acid alternatives which translates to many years of reliable power.
• Higher Usable Energy: Lithium batteries usually allow greater usable capacity (up to 90% or more) without damaging the cells, meaning more of your stored energy is available for use.
• Improved Efficiency: Lithium cells charge and discharge with minimal energy loss, making them ideal for solar installations where every watt matters.
• Low Maintenance: Unlike flooded and tubular lead‑acid batteries that require regular servicing, lithium batteries are generally maintenance‑free.
• Better Safety and Stability: LiFePO₄ chemistry, commonly used in current lithium batteries, offers excellent thermal stability and safety, which is critical in Pakistan’s high‑heat conditions.
These characteristics combine to deliver greater performance, reduced operational costs, and longer service life, making lithium batteries a smart choice for both new solar installations and inverter backup upgrades.
How to Evaluate a Lithium Battery Before Buying
When assessing lithium battery options, consider the following:
-
Voltage and Compatibility: Most homes and solar systems in Pakistan use 48‑volt lithium batteries. Ensure your inverter or solar hybrid system supports the voltage and communication protocols (such as CAN or RS485) of the battery.
-
Cycle Life and Warranty: Higher cycle ratings generally indicate longer life. Look for batteries rated for at least several thousand cycles, backed by multi‑year warranties from the brand or distributor.
-
Battery Chemistry: LiFePO₄ is preferred for solar and backup systems due to safety and durability.
-
Brand Support and Service: Local availability of support, service centers, and authorized dealers in cities like Lahore, Karachi, and Islamabad simplifies maintenance and warranty claims.
-
Installation and Monitoring Features: Modern batteries with BMS (Battery Management Systems), smart displays, and connectivity options like Bluetooth or Wi‑Fi make installation and monitoring easier.

Fronus
Fronus has become a familiar name in Pakistan’s energy market with lithium battery packs that match well with common hybrid inverters and solar systems. These LiFePO₄ batteries typically come in 48 volt configurations with capacities around 100 Ah (approximately 5 kWh energy storage) suitable for homes and small businesses. Fronus batteries are known for decent cycle counts, stable performance, and built‑in battery management systems that protect against overcharge, over‑discharge, and temperature issues, making them a practical choice for many residential solar setups.
Fronus batteries are modular, lightweight, and designed for maintenance‑free operation, though user feedback suggests prospective buyers should confirm warranty and service support in their area before purchase.
Best for: Residential solar systems and inverter backups across Pakistan.
Strengths: LiFePO₄ safety, integrated BMS, compatible with hybrid inverters.
Typical Features: ~5 kWh capacity, ~100 Ah, wall‑mount or rack‑mount design, smart BMS protection.

DJDC (Dongjin)
DJDC, often associated with the Dongjin battery line, covers a range of lithium batteries from smaller 12 V and 24 V options up to full 48 V energy storage systems suitable for hybrid solar and UPS applications. These batteries typically include smart features such as LCD displays and connectivity via Bluetooth or Wi‑Fi, along with advanced BMS protection for overcharge and temperature safeguards. They are suitable for various use cases — from residential solar to off‑grid and backup power.
Best for: Small to medium solar systems, inverter backups, off‑grid setups.
Strengths: Smart monitoring features, LiFePO₄ chemistry, wide range of capacities (12 V to 48 V), integrated BMS.
Typical Features: Smart display, Bluetooth/Wi‑Fi monitoring, solid cycle life.
